Head West of Chamberlain about 30 miles to a town called Kennebic. Used to stay at a motel right off the freeway that always had a list of farmers/ranchers that were looking for "help" with the population of skippy.

Eastern Montana. No age or limits on private land. Call local motels and ask if there are any ranchers that need help. As long as you can close a gate most are grateful for the help.
 
Call the local Scheels, Cabelas or Red Rock Sporting goods gun counter and ask about varmint rifles and optics suggestions. Steer the conversation towards an upcoming trip and ask for possible places or even if one of the guys at the counter can take you out for a day for a minimal fee. Just make sure that when you call its not around the lunch rotation or within 30min of closing time, you stand a better chance of getting a chatty dude to hang out for a bit on the phone.
If shooting in SE Montana or any of the plains areas out West, be damn sure you don't get stuck out there in the gumbo after a rain shower. Also do not make ruts on the roads and fuck everything up hot rodding around, it will be the last time most ranchers will allow you on the property. Be polite, reserved and reassure them you will close the gate, not leave ruts and you know the difference between a cow and a coyote.
